Utility Balcony Design for New Town Apartments: Making 20 Sq Ft Work

If you have walked into a new flat in New Town and found a narrow slab tacked onto the kitchen or the master bedroom, roughly the size of a large dining table and about as useful right now, you already know the problem this piece is about. Builders across Action Area I, II and III have started handing over apartments with a dedicated utility balcony, usually somewhere between 18 and 25 square feet, meant for the washing machine, the RO waste line, and whatever else the kitchen does not have room for. Nobody hands you a plan for it. It just sits there, half a laundry room and half an afterthought, until the first monsoon shows you exactly where the water is going to pool.

Worth saying upfront that a utility balcony is not a bonus room, it is a working space with a drain, a water point, and usually an exhaust requirement, so the design decisions here are closer to bathroom planning than to balcony-as-view-deck planning, and that distinction is where most DIY attempts go wrong.
Why New Town utility balconies are the size they are
The 20 square foot utility balcony you are looking at is not an accident of your builder being stingy, it is largely a function of how setback rules and permissible projections work under NKDA norms, which cap how far any balcony or utility projection can extend from the building line and how much of the sanctioned floor area ratio a developer can spend on service areas versus habitable rooms. Builders squeeze the utility balcony to the minimum that still satisfies the plumbing and ventilation requirement for a washing machine outlet, because every extra square foot there is a square foot not sold as bedroom or living area. The other reason the space feels tight is that most utility balconies in New Town towers get boxed in on three sides by the building's own service shafts, drain risers, and the neighbouring flat's wall, which limits how much daylight and cross-ventilation actually reaches in, even though on paper the balcony faces open air. That matters for material choice later in this piece, because a space that stays damp longer needs different flooring and different cabinetry decisions than a balcony that dries out in an hour of sun.
What actually needs to fit in 20 square feet
Before you sketch anything, list the functions honestly. In our experience across New Town flats, a working utility balcony needs to hold a front-load or top-load washing machine, a dry rack or fold-down line for at least one day's laundry, a small storage shelf for detergent and cleaning supplies, floor drainage that can handle an overflow without backing into the kitchen, and increasingly, an outdoor unit mounting point for the AC condenser if the balcony doubles as service space. That is five functions in a footprint smaller than most bathrooms, so the order in which you plan them matters more than the finishes you pick.
- Washing machine with clearance for door swing or top loading
- Wet zone flooring sloped correctly to the floor drain
- Dry storage shelf raised off the floor, away from splash
- Foldable or retractable drying line, not a fixed rod that eats headroom
- Exhaust or louvred window for airflow, since a sealed balcony traps moisture
- Junction box and switch positioned away from the wet zone
Where we see people go wrong is treating the whole 20 square feet as one continuous surface, when it should really be split into a wet zone around the machine and drain, and a dry zone for storage and folding, with the transition marked by a slight floor level change or a strip drain, so water from the machine's discharge cycle never travels toward the shelf. This is basic wet-dry zoning, the same logic that goes into a compact bathroom design, just scaled down and applied to laundry instead of showering.
| Do this | Not this |
|---|---|
| Slope the floor 1:80 toward a single drain point | Leave the floor flat and hope water finds the drain on its own |
| Fix the washing machine's outlet pipe into the wall with a proper trap | Let the discharge hose just hang loose over the balcony edge |
| Use a raised, ventilated shelf for detergent and supplies | Stack everything on the floor where splashback ruins packaging |
| Route the AC condensate line to the same drain, planned at design stage | Add a condensate line later and let it drip onto the balcony floor |
Materials that survive Kolkata's humidity, not just look good on day one
New Town sits close enough to the Rajarhat wetlands and gets a long, wet monsoon stretch that a utility balcony finished in the wrong material will show mould, grout discolouration, or lifted tiles within a year, which is a common enough complaint that we now build it into the brief by default rather than waiting for the client to ask. For flooring, we specify anti-skid vitrified tile or a matte ceramic with a proper coefficient of friction rating, never the glossy tile that looks good in a showroom and turns into a hazard the moment it is wet, and we have written more on how to pick between the two in our piece on anti-skid vitrified versus matt ceramic balcony flooring. For the shelf and any cabinetry you fit into the dry zone, we avoid raw plywood carcasses without a marine-grade or BWP rating, because ordinary board swells and delaminates in a space that never fully dries between wash cycles. Choosing and placing the washing machine so it doesn't wreck the balcony or your sleep
Most people treat the washing machine as a fixed constraint, something that arrives after the interiors are done and just gets shoved into whatever gap is left, and that is exactly the assumption that causes half the repeat calls we get on utility balconies six months after handover, because the machine itself, its footprint, its spin cycle vibration, and the noise it throws into the flat, is actually one of the bigger design variables in a 20 square foot room, not an afterthought you bolt on at the end.
The first decision is front-load versus top-load, and in New Town's utility balconies we lean front-load more often than not, not because it is the trendier choice but because a front-load machine gives you a flat top surface you can actually use, a shelf for detergent, a spot to rest a laundry basket, a place to sit a small drying rack, whereas a top-load machine eats that entire vertical plane for its lid swing and leaves you with nothing above it except wasted air. The tradeoff is that front-load machines run a faster spin cycle, typically 1000 to 1400 RPM against a top-load's 700 to 800, and that faster spin is where the vibration problem actually comes from, so if your utility balcony shares a wall with a bedroom, which in a lot of New Town floor plans it does because the builder stacked the service zones together, that vibration transmits through the slab and the wall as a low hum that people only notice at eleven at night when they are trying to sleep and someone downstairs or next door runs a load.
The fix is not complicated but it is almost never done, and it is simply this, the machine should sit on a proper anti-vibration pad or a rubber-cork isolation mat rather than directly on tile, and its feet should be levelled properly at install rather than left tilted on whatever slope the floor has toward the drain, because an unlevelled machine on a hard floor amplifies vibration instead of damping it, and that single levelling step, which takes a technician maybe ten minutes, is the difference between a balcony that hums quietly and one that rattles the adjoining wall on every spin cycle. Where the balcony sits directly against a bedroom, we sometimes go a step further and specify a decoupled sub-base under the machine, basically an isolated slab-on-pad rather than the machine sitting straight on structural floor, and that is a design decision that has to be made before tiling, not after someone complains.
The other placement issue that gets ignored is the electrical point, because a lot of utility balconies we inspect at handover have a standard, non-weatherproof socket sitting inches from the wet zone, sometimes literally above where the machine's discharge hose sits, and that is a genuine safety gap, not a cosmetic one, so we specify a weatherproof, IP-rated socket with its own RCD or ELCB protection on that circuit as a baseline, positioned in the dry zone and routed so the cable never crosses the wet floor even when someone is filling a bucket next to the machine. Combine that with the machine's own footprint and vibration behaviour and you get a placement decision that is really three decisions stacked together, where the machine sits relative to the drain, how it is isolated from the structural floor, and where the power point lands relative to both, and getting that sequence right at the drawing stage is a lot cheaper than isolating a machine after the tile is down and the neighbour has already complained about the 11pm hum through the wall.
Making 20 square feet feel like more than a storage closet
The design moves that actually change how the space feels are mostly about sightlines and light, not about squeezing in more storage. A single well-placed louvred window or ventilator does more for the feel of a utility balcony than any amount of clever shelving, because it lets the space breathe and stops it reading as a dark, damp appendage to the kitchen. If your balcony gets any daylight at all, even indirect daylighting through a frosted pane keeps the space from feeling like a service cupboard, and a warm-white light fixture at around 3000K colour temperature rather than a stark tube light makes the difference between a space you avoid and one you don't mind stepping into.
